Title: Fungal parasite of Anabaena
Description: An unnamed biflagellate fungal parasite of Anabaena. An exit tube (5 Micrometre br.) is developing from the, as yet, immature thread-like sporangium within the Anabaena. Far left: an encysted zoospore of a chytrid saprophyte with rhizoids just beginning to develop.
